| said by Rawr:Okay, so is AT and T capping my internet? It the GATEWAY said 6mb down and 768kb up the other day. Now its 2mb down and 300 kb up. Does capping ever stop? No they are not capping your internet. Capping is defined as slowing down or limiting the amount you can download. You are talking about the speed of your connection, which is defined as an UP to limit. There are many reason(s) that can effect your connection speed, and why DSL is always an UP TO 6mb down 768up |

 wayjacPremium,MVM join:2001-12-22 Indy kudos:1 | reply to Rawr Your internet is not being "capped"
When the dsl line is noisy the speed will be reduced so that the dsl can maintain a internet connection The problem may be caused by the dwellings phone wiring |

| reply to Rawr I would have loved to seen what it synced at, at the nid/sni test jack. I have seen failing filters do this or nid splitters gone bad. if a nid/sni splitter is going bad or going open the attenuation numbers will shoot up there pretty quick.
On mine, when my nid/sni splitter committed suicide last year the lowest attenuation I could get was 63 downstream. Now I knew that I had 6mbps and that number should be at or lower than 40db. Tested at the nid/sni without the splitter or the rest of the phones and found the same 40db there. Checked at the splitter and sure enough it was 40db before the splitter and 63 after.
